New York Jets quarterback Zach Wilson is not at voluntary workouts this week.
He continues to be away from the team since his name has been in trade rumors since the season ended. The expectation is that he’ll be traded at some point during the offseason but no deal has been agreed to yet.
Wilson was granted permission to speak to other teams about a trade in February. He hasn’t lived up to expectations and it’s why both sides are looking for a fresh start.
Wilson was picked second overall in the 2021 NFL Draft and played in 13 games that season, finishing with 2,334 yards through the air, nine touchdowns, and 11 interceptions.
It wasn’t the rookie season that Jets fans were hoping for but it was only his first year. Well, things didn’t get better in his second season after he played in nine games and compiled 1,688 yards through the air, six touchdowns, and seven interceptions.
He then had to start this past season even though he was supposed to be Aaron Rodgers’ backup. It didn’t go according to plan and he’s now on the trade block.
